§ 9861, 9862. Repealed. Pub. L. 103–382, title III, § 391(w), Oct. 20, 1994, 108 Stat. 4025

Pub. L. 103–382, title III, § 391(w) , Oct. 20, 1994 , 108 Stat. 4025 Section 9861, Pub. L. 97–35, title VI, § 662 , Aug. 13, 1981 , 95 Stat. 508 ; Pub. L. 101–501, title II, § 202 , Nov. 3, 1990 , 104 Stat. 1243 , authorized financial assistance for Follow Through programs. Section 9862, Pub. L. 97–35, title VI, § 663 , as added Pub. L. 101–501, title II, § 203 , Nov. 3, 1990 , 104 Stat. 1244 ; amended Pub. L. 102–119, § 26(c) , Oct. 7, 1991 , 105 Stat. 607 , related to consideration of applications.
A prior section 9862, Pub. L. 97–35, title VI, § 663 , Aug. 13, 1981 , 95 Stat. 509 ; Pub. L. 98–558, title III, § 301 , Oct. 30, 1984 , 98 Stat. 2887 ; Pub. L. 99–425, title II, § 201(a) , Sept. 30, 1986 , 100 Stat. 966 , related to funding requirements, prior to repeal by Pub. L. 101–501, title II, § 203 , Nov. 3, 1990 , 104 Stat. 1244 .
